webtouch(webapp)页面,防苹果手机safari浏览器,网上滑动,底部导航消失,滑动到底部又出现。向下滑动,底部导航出现。 遇到问题 1、我一开始用swipeup和swipedown来做,发现因为有滚动条,不会触发。因此只能判断滚动条是上滚下滚等。关于手机手势,后面的文章会介绍,欢迎关注 ...
分类:
Web程序 时间:
2018-01-21 16:26:04
阅读次数:
206
经常在网页中看到这样一种效果,当页面滚动一段距离后,页面中的某个部分固定在一个区域(通常是头部导航),这种效果一般称为Sticky Header,如下图所示: 上述操作在Android系统中非常好实现,只需要监听onscroll事件并将实现逻辑写在里面即可,但iOS则不一样,它在页面scroll的时 ...
分类:
移动开发 时间:
2018-01-09 23:14:48
阅读次数:
324
一、遇顶固定的例子 我一直以为是某个div或层随屏幕滚动,遇顶则固定,离开浏览器顶部又还原这样的例子其实不少,其实它的名字叫“层的智能浮动效果”。目前我们在国内的商业网站上就常常看到这样的效果了。例如淘宝网的搜索结果页的排序水平条,在默认状态时,该工具条是跟随页面滚动的,如下图: 而当我们下拉滚动条 ...
分类:
Web程序 时间:
2018-01-08 13:37:39
阅读次数:
2181
Cordova + vue 打包成 APP 后在部分安卓机上面,左右滑动无法正常的实现页面滚动逻辑。 解决方案: 在 touchMove 的时候,通过 event.preventDefault() 来解决 注意: transform 事件是有兼容性的,可不要忘记加前缀。 ...
分类:
移动开发 时间:
2018-01-06 14:26:19
阅读次数:
205
默认情况下mui 页面不能滚动,以下为解决方案: 1. mui('.mui-scroll-wrapper').scroll({ deceleration: 0.0005 //flick 减速系数,系数越大,滚动速度越慢,滚动距离越小,默认值0.0006 }); 2.(function($){ ...
分类:
其他好文 时间:
2018-01-04 18:13:02
阅读次数:
135
1.1. 页面滚动不流畅(2017-09-25) 现象: 网页竖向滚动或横向滚动不流畅。 解决方案: 为滚动元素添加css样式: -webkit-overflow-scrolling: touch; 1 详见MDN-webkit-overflow-scrolling 1.2. 横向滚动时会上下跳动( ...
分类:
微信 时间:
2017-12-23 14:13:34
阅读次数:
291
1、地址引入 2、HTML部分 注:bounceInRight为animate.css中的动画方式,具体可见官方API给出的示例:https://daneden.github.io/animate.css 3、wow.js初始化代码 注:以下是一些自定义配置: ...
分类:
Web程序 时间:
2017-12-21 19:37:59
阅读次数:
222
方法:使用布局控制 页面中内容要放在一个和网页一样大的元素A中 (内容中有一个元素B有滚动条) 先给body和html、元素A设置 width:100%;height:100%; 元素A设置overflow: auto; 给元素A加一个class=‘hidden’ 写样式 .hidden{ over ...
分类:
移动开发 时间:
2017-12-11 18:57:47
阅读次数:
212
问题描述 1. 进入页面, 滚动到底部 2. 点击一个连接, 当前视图内容更新了 3. 内容滚动到了上次的位置导致底部的内容没显示 需要控制自动回滚到顶部 " " true和false是用来控制动画的 $ionicScrollDelegate 官网的文档说的很清楚, 用来控制ionic conten ...
分类:
其他好文 时间:
2017-12-09 18:12:06
阅读次数:
136
// 开启、禁止页面滚动 bodyScroll: { e(e) { e.preventDefault();// 注意此处代码片段必须这样提出来已保证传入下边两个事件的处理程序一样才生效,分别写到事件处理程序中不生效。 }, // 开启滚动 open() { document.body.... ...
分类:
Web程序 时间:
2017-12-06 10:38:20
阅读次数:
331